WebGeorge Washington Bush (1779 – April 5, 1863) was an American pioneer and one of the first African-American (Irish and African) [1] non- Amerindian settlers of the Pacific Northwest. [2] Early life and education [ edit] George Bush was born in Pennsylvania around 1779. An only child, he was raised as a Quaker and educated in Philadelphia. [2] msプレーンタイル
